Complex surface reconstruction based on vision has received much attention in the Computer Vision area in recent years. In this field, a number of different approaches to surface height reconstruction from a single image (shape from shading) are analyzed and discussed in this paper. Based on these approaches, with the theory of minimization of functional, an iteration method of surface orientation and surface height reconstruction from a single image is concluded and with Gauss-Newton iteration,...